Lyophilization: Validation and regulatory approaches

Lyophilization and its validation and regulatory approaches form an important aspect of parenteral drugs.

Lyophilization is a process in which a product is frozen and placed in a vacuum and water is removed from it. This removes the need for the liquid stage in the change of ice from solid to vapor. This process consists of three phases: primary, sublimation and desorption.

Lyophilization is considered complex

Parenteral products such as anti-infective drugs, many biotechnological products and in-vitro diagnostic products are some of the areas in which lyophilization is used. However, no matter for which field lyophilization is used, it is considered rather tough.

This is mainly because the process of obtaining the product from the lyophilization process is rather complex. It has to be carried out through a number of minute and delicate processes. Complex technology goes into the entire process.

Solution formulation, filling up vials and the validation of this process, sterilization, engineering, and the act of scaling up of the lyophilization cycle and its validation are some of the issues that make lyophilization difficult. Moreover, the processing and handling time needed for lyophilization is pretty high, as is the cost and complexity of the machinery and equipment needed for lyophilization.

Regulatory issues as well

On top of all these, the process of lyophilization has to be compliant with FDA compliance requirements. This adds to the complexity of lyophilization. However, despite these difficulties associated in many ways, lyophilization is a process that cannot be done away with, since it has tangible benefits for parenteral products.
